Randy Brown vs. Muslim Salikhov Booked for UFC 296 on Dec. 16

The final Ultimate Fighting Championship pay-per-view event of 2023 has picked up a potential banger of a welterweight matchup.

Advertisement

Randy Brown (17-5) and Muslim Salikhov (19-4) are reportedly booked to meet at UFC 296 in December. Brown broke the news of the booking on his Discord along with @Full_Violence on Twitter. “Rude Boy” had a four-fight win streak snapped at UFC 284 in February, thanks to a first-round submission by Jack Della Maddalena. “Rude Boy” has since regained some momentum with a decision victory over Wellington Turman in June.

Salikhov went on a five-fight win streak starting with his sophomore UFC outing which included wins over the likes of Elizeu Zaleski dos Santos and Francisco Trinaldo. However, “King of Kung Fu” has since gone 1-2 in his last three, including a decision loss against Nicolas Dalby in his most recent Octagon outing back in June.

UFC 296 takes place on Dec. 16 at T-Mobile Arena in Las Vegas. While the full lineup has yet to be finalized, the main card already includes two title fights, with Leon Edwards defending his welterweight belt against multiple-time title challenger Colby Covington in the main event, and Alexandre Pantoja set to stake his flyweight strap against Brandon Royval.
